Anchoring Your Smile with Permanent Stability
When you lose a tooth, the root is just as important as the visible portion. While we provide the prosthetic tooth, our dental crowns in Slinger, WI are specifically engineered to attach to a titanium post, creating a foundation that mimics the strength of a natural root. This synergy between the implant and the crown ensures that your replacement tooth won't slip or shift, providing a level of permanence that traditional bridges simply cannot match. By choosing this path, we are helping you invest in a solution that supports the health of your entire jaw.
Preserving Bone Health Through Restoration
One of the most significant advantages of choosing an implant-supported restoration is its ability to prevent bone loss. When we place dental crowns in Slinger, WI on top of a dental implant, the pressure from chewing stimulates the jawbone, signaling it to remain dense and strong. Without this stimulation, the bone can begin to resorb over time, leading to changes in your facial structure. We take great care to ensure your new crown is shaped to facilitate this vital biological process, keeping your smile and jaw healthy.
By maintaining this bone density, we also protect the roots of your adjacent natural teeth. A sturdy jawbone provides the necessary foundation for your entire mouth, preventing the "domino effect" of tooth loss that often follows an untreated gap. Our commitment to high-quality restorations ensures that your mouth remains structurally sound, allowing you to maintain your natural facial contours and a youthful appearance for years to come.
Sophisticated Materials for a Seamless Match
We believe that a restoration should be felt but not seen. Our team uses advanced ceramic and zirconia materials when creating dental crowns in Slinger, WI, because these materials offer the best combination of strength and beauty. We meticulously match the color, contour, and even the texture of the crown to your surrounding natural teeth. This ensures that when you speak or smile, the light reflects off the restoration in the same way it does your natural enamel, providing you with a result you can be proud of.
Long-Term Care for Your Implant Restoration
Because your new tooth is anchored into the bone, it requires a different kind of attention than a traditional crown. We provide specific guidance for our patients with dental crowns in Slinger, WI to ensure the tissue surrounding the implant remains free of inflammation. Maintaining a healthy environment around the restoration is the best way to prevent complications and ensure your investment lasts a lifetime.
To keep your new smile in top condition, we recommend the following:
- Use Non-Abrasive Cleaning Tools: Choose a soft-bristled toothbrush and non-abrasive paste to avoid scratching the polished surface of the crown.
- Utilize Interdental Brushes: These small brushes are excellent for cleaning the space where the crown meets the gum line, an area where standard floss might struggle.
- Regular Clinical Exams: We need to check the "abutment," or the connector piece, periodically to ensure it remains tightly secured to the implant.
- Water Flossers: Using a water flosser can be a gentle and effective way to remove debris from underneath the margins of the restoration.
By following these targeted hygiene steps, you are protecting the integrity of the implant-to-bone bond. These habits prevent the buildup of harmful bacteria that could otherwise threaten the stability of your dental work.
Precision Engineering for a Comfortable Bite
The final stage of the implant process is the most delicate, as we must ensure the new tooth fits perfectly into your existing bite pattern. When installing dental crowns in Slinger, WI, we use articulating indicators to check that the restoration doesn't hit too "high" or with too much force. A perfectly balanced bite prevents the implant from being overloaded and ensures that your jaw muscles remain relaxed and comfortable.
